  • Page 9 DT-6260 can be used interchangeable. The IP-SPOOL and other applications will run on all three platforms. The DT-6160 and DT-6260 are the next generation of the DT-6061. They have faster processors and more memory. The DT-6160 supports up to 30 instances of up to 5 different applications, and the DT- 6260 supports 48 instances.

    The timeout command configures the session timer. Its range is 15 to 254 seconds. When configured, the session timer will disconnect a user from the OA&M telnet port for this IP- SPOOL instance. No other instances on the DT-6XXX are affected since each has its own OA&M connection. 04/13/06 Datatek Applications Inc.

    B2APRT sets up a TCP call to the IP-SPOOL instance to a virtual printer. Each instance corresponds to one virtual printer. The IP-B2APRT application uses the TCP port numbers shown above to access a virtual printer in IP-SPOOL. 04/13/06 Datatek Applications Inc.
